How they compare
Latvia currently reports 4.9% against 4.4% in Qatar, a difference of 0.5%.
That makes Latvia's figure about 1.1 times Qatar's.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 17 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Qatar ahead.
Latvia ranks 84th and Qatar ranks 87th of 123 countries.
Qatar has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Latvia | Qatar |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 3.7% | 7.7% | 4.0% | Qatar |
| 2010s | 4.8% | 9.1% | 4.4% | Qatar |
| 2020s | 4.6% | 6.0% | 1.4% | Qatar |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
